如何在rowupdating事件中获取gridview的boundfield值

时间:2016-03-04 11:47:46

标签: c# asp.net gridview

我想选择数据绑定字段值。我得到编译错误说不包含细胞定义

<asp:GridView ID="gvBankDetails" runat="server" AutoGenerateColumns="false" AutoGenerateEditButton="true" OnRowEditing="gvBankDetails_RowEditing" OnRowCancelingEdit="gvBankDetails_RowCancelingEdit" OnRowUpdating="gvBankDetails_RowUpdating">
                        <Columns>

     <asp:BoundField HeaderText="sl no" DataField="id" />
</Columns>
</Gridview>




protected void gvBankDetails_RowUpdating(object sender, GridViewUpdateEventArgs e)
    {

        string dtr = ((TextBox)gvBankDetails.Cells[0].Controls[0]).Text;
    }

2 个答案:

答案 0 :(得分:2)

获取网格视图中绑定字段的值

protected void gvBankDetails_RowUpdating(object sender, GridViewUpdateEventArgs e)
    {
 string strName = ((TextBox)gvBankDetails.Rows[e.RowIndex].Cells[3].Controls[0]).Text;
    }

答案 1 :(得分:0)

show queue 

索引可能因列号

而不同
相关问题